22 Bus Stop

Advertisement

Lorain Ave
Cleveland, OH 44102

This bus stop at 22 Bus Stop on Lorain Ave in Cleveland, OH, US, provides a convenient and accessible spot for commuters to wait for their rides.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esOhioCleveland22 Bus Stop

Partial Data by Foursquare.

Advertisement